Talent.com
This job offer is not available in your country.
CCB QA Automation Engineer

CCB QA Automation Engineer

12542 Citicorp Services India Private LimitedPune Maharashtra India
30+ days ago
Job type
  • Full-time
Job description

Overview of Citi :

Citi is a world-leading global bank. We have approximately 200 million customer accounts and a presence in more than 160 countries and jurisdictions worldwide. We provide consumers, corporations, governments, and institutions with a broad range of financial products and services, including consumer banking and credit, corporate and investment banking, securities brokerage, transaction services, and wealth management. We enable clients to achieve their strategic financial objectives by providing them with cutting-edge ideas, best-in-class products and solutions, and unparalleled access to capital and liquidity.

Team / Function Overview :

The Citi Commercial Bank testing function is responsible for major client onboarding testing initiatives, including but not limited to Account opening and servicing, Periodic Reviews and Lending. The team has presence in Belfast, Shanghai, India, Mississauga and Irving. The team is undergoing an agile transformation, so experience of agile principles and ways of working would be beneficial.

Role Overview

The Testing Intermediate Analyst is a developing professional role. Deals with most problems independently and has some latitude to solve complex problems. Integrates in-depth specialty area knowledge with a solid understanding of industry standards and practices. Good understanding of how the team and area integrate with others in accomplishing the objectives of the sub function / job family. Applies analytical thinking and knowledge of data analysis tools and methodologies. Requires attention to detail when making judgments and recommendations based on the analysis of factual information. Typically deals with variable issues with potentially broader business impact. Applies professional judgment when interpreting data and results. Breaks down information in a systematic and communicable manner. Developed communication and diplomacy skills are required in order to exchange potentially complex / sensitive information. Moderate but direct impact through close contact with the businesses' core activities. Quality and timeliness of service provided will affect the effectiveness of own team and other closely related teams.

Responsibilities :

  • Tests and analyzes a broad range of systems and applications to ensure they meet or exceed specified standards and end-user requirements.
  • Work closely with key stakeholders to understand business and functional requirements to develop test plans, test cases and automation scripts.
  • Executes test scripts according to application requirements documentation.
  • Manual and Automation testing and thorough knowledge around Agile testing methodologies.
  • To take complete ownership of the given application and proactively Identifies risks and recommends appropriate course of action; performs root cause analysis.
  • Documents, evaluates and researches test results for future replication.
  • Ability to drive automation strategy towards in sprint automation or sprint minus one state
  • Proactively Identifies, recommends and implements process improvements to enhance testing strategies.
  • Analyzes requirements and design aspects of projects. Interfaces with stakeholder, BA leads and development teams.
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ency.

Qualifications :

  • 4-7 years Quality Assurance experienced professional who has worked in functional and predominantly in test automation.
  • Experience of working in Agile environment where you should have ability to work under pressure during tight deadlines
  • Strong experience in Test Automation using Selenium or Python including framework maintenance, Framework Optimization, Automation Strategizing, Automation Planning and Automation Test Execution.
  • Good experience in IDE like intellij or Eclipse
  • Strong expertise in testing tools - Selenium, BDD, Cucumber with strong understanding of OOPS concepts
  • Strong experience in Test Automation testing frameworks like TestNg, Junit
  • Strong hands on experience with languages like Java or Python (pytest).
  • Exposure to version control tool like GIT / SVN and CI / CD tools like Jenkins
  • Experience in webservice Automation using Rest Assured / Postman or any other open-source tool.
  • Education :

  • Bachelor’s / University degree or equivalent experience
  • Job Family Group : Technology

    Job Family : Technology Quality

    Time Type : Full time

    Citi is an equal opportunity and affirmative action employer.

    Qualified applicants will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.

    Citigroup Inc. and its subsidiaries ("Citi”) invite all qualified interested applicants to apply for career opportunities. If you are a person with a disability and need a reasonable accommodation to use our search tools and / or apply for a career opportunity review .